Fórmula para calcular la eficiencia mecánica para un tipo de máquina específico

Un usuario Pregunto ✅

Susan_Colyn

Hola,

Necesito ayuda con una fórmula de Dax.

Tengo que calcular la Eficiencia Mecánica y tengo la fórmula para esto, pero mis datos incluyen diferentes tipos de máquinas y me gustaría agregar un tipo de filtro a la fórmula, ya que solo quiero la Eficiencia Mecánica para un tipo determinado.

Ella son mis datos: ubicación de la máquina, tipo (máquina de llenado o equipo aguas abajo), tiempo de producción, tiempo de parada del equipo

Ejemplo 1.jpg

La fórmula que tengo actualmente para la eficiencia mecánica es

Ejemplo 2.jpg

¿Hay algún tipo de filtro que agregue a esta fórmula para obtener solo el resultado de FM?

Saludos,

Susan

HotChilli

Una medida sería (los nombres pueden ser diferentes a su lado)

MMEFM = SUMX(FILTER(MME, MME[objType] = "FM"), DIVIDE(SUM(MME[PT fm/de]), SUM(MME[PT fm/de]) + SUM(MME[EST fm/de])))

Hay otras formas de hacerlo. Active «Mostrar elementos sin datos» en una visualización de tabla para ver los otros tipos de objetos

¿Tengo razón en que solo tiene sentido en un contexto de fila? Si es así, la columna calculada sería

ColumnMMEFM = IF (MME[objType] = "FM", DIVIDE(MME[PT fm/de], MME[PT fm/de] + MME[EST fm/de]),0)

HotChilli

Una medida sería (los nombres pueden ser diferentes a su lado)

MMEFM = SUMX(FILTER(MME, MME[objType] = "FM"), DIVIDE(SUM(MME[PT fm/de]), SUM(MME[PT fm/de]) + SUM(MME[EST fm/de])))

Hay otras formas de hacerlo. Active «Mostrar elementos sin datos» en una visualización de tabla para ver los otros tipos de objetos

¿Tengo razón en que solo tiene sentido en un contexto de fila? Si es así, la columna calculada sería

ColumnMMEFM = IF (MME[objType] = "FM", DIVIDE(MME[PT fm/de], MME[PT fm/de] + MME[EST fm/de]),0)

Susan_Colyn

En respuesta a HotChilli

Hola,

Gracias por ayudar, pero necesito más ayuda, por favor. Pensé que la fórmula funcionaba, pero todavía tenía seleccionado «FM» en el filtro de página. Simplemente lo eliminé y el resultado es incorrecto. No filtra «FM».

Probé la fórmula IF y solo permite medidas después de IF. Recibí un error al usar el nombre de la columna.

¿Hay otra fórmula que pueda usar?

Susan_Colyn

En respuesta a HotChilli

Gracias, usé la fórmula SUMX y funciona perfectamente

Deja un comentario

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*